The Pittsburgh Post-Gazette says Le'Veon Bell and LeGarrette Blount "probably face no more than a one-game suspension and that won't come anytime soon."
There's plenty of precedent here that will allow Bell and Blount to suit up for the entire season. In cases like this pending marijuana possession charge, the NFL waits for the legal process to play out before handing down discipline under the personal conduct policy. Lawyers won't have a problem delaying any proceedings. Note that Dwayne Bowe was caught with marijuana in a car last November, and didn't get hit with his one-game ban until last week.

From Rotoworld

Bell, Blount to play
quote:

Pittsburgh Steelers running backs Le'Veon Bell and LeGarrette Blount will play in Thursday night's preseason game against the Philadelphia Eagles, sources told ESPN's Ed Werder, despite the fact they will be charged with marijuana possession after a traffic stop Wednesday.

Steelers coach Mike Tomlin met with the players Thursday morning as he decided how to proceed, and a source says that it will be "business as usual'' for Bell and Blount because the Steelers have a lot to work on offensively.
